CSS,即Cascading Style Sheets,是一種用于網(wǎng)頁(yè)設(shè)計(jì)的樣式表語(yǔ)言。它是HTML的一個(gè)重要補(bǔ)充,通過(guò)將文本和元素添加樣式,提高了網(wǎng)站的可讀性和美觀(guān)程度。
CSS主要分為:內(nèi)聯(lián)樣式、內(nèi)部樣式和外部樣式。內(nèi)聯(lián)樣式是直接在HTML標(biāo)簽內(nèi)添加樣式代碼,一般使用較少,影響整體可讀性;內(nèi)部樣式是在HTML頭部添加樣式表鏈接的方法,可以控制整個(gè)網(wǎng)頁(yè)的樣式,但無(wú)法在多個(gè)頁(yè)面之間共享;外部樣式是將CSS代碼寫(xiě)在外部文件中,并在HTML中通過(guò)鏈接引用,可以在多個(gè)頁(yè)面共享樣式,讓網(wǎng)站整體風(fēng)格更加統(tǒng)一。
/* 外部樣式的CSS代碼應(yīng)該寫(xiě)在style.css文件內(nèi) */ body { font-family: "Microsoft YaHei", Arial, sans-serif; background-color: #f5f5f5; } h1 { font-size: 36px; font-weight: bold; color: #333; } p { font-size: 16px; color: #666; line-height: 1.6; } a { text-decoration: none; color: #0078c1; } button { border: none; padding: 10px 20px; background-color: #0078c1; color: #fff; font-size: 16px; border-radius: 4px; }
除了可以對(duì)文字進(jìn)行樣式的設(shè)置外,CSS還可以對(duì)頁(yè)面布局、盒子模型等進(jìn)行控制。比如,可以使用margin和padding設(shè)置元素與外邊距和內(nèi)邊距,還可以使用position、float和display等屬性來(lái)控制元素的位置和布局。
在網(wǎng)頁(yè)設(shè)計(jì)中,CSS的作用是非常重要的。它可以讓網(wǎng)頁(yè)看起來(lái)更加美觀(guān)和整潔,也有利于SEO的優(yōu)化,同時(shí)還可以讓設(shè)計(jì)師對(duì)網(wǎng)頁(yè)樣式的設(shè)定更加精確和個(gè)性化。